Fall Garden 2019

Fall is here and it is the best season of the year IMHO.  Time to harvest and close down the garden.

Cucumber is my favorite summer veggie.  I was able to harvest continually about 4x 5 gallon-bucket of fresh cukes.
This is the oldest apple tree on our farm.  I suspect it is over 30 years old.

In previous years, the apples had blight, scab and were usually sour.  We could use may be 10% of the harvest.

However, this year we have a bumper crop and the apples are sweet and crisp, without much blemish.

I did NOT do anything this year to this old tree so I am feeling overwhelmed.

Drying garlic for storage and planting in October.
This is fall lettuce.
This is a new 3″ x 8″ square where I will be planting garlic.
3 plants of spaghetti squash produce 18 fruits.
